1 Corinthians 11:1 (KJV): Be ye followers of me, even as I also am of Christ.
WISDOM FOR THE SUBMITTED CHRISTIAN
The instructions of your spiritual authority must always be submitted to the Word of God.
In the church of Christ today, it is sad to see some Christians exalting what is spoken by pastors, apostles, prophets or any spiritual authority above what God says.
Succinctly, it is this thinking and attitude that makes ‘God’ of the minister instead of Jehovah. It is therefore contrary to the gospel of Jesus Christ.
No man of God died for your sins only Jesus the Messiah did. So listen to your man of God but only according to truth!
Don’t perish because of him or her. Follow him or her as he or she follows Christ.
Christ is the standard. Hallelujah!
